Comparing two arrays in jquery

Using this code...

var a = ['volvo','random data'];
var b = ['random data'];
var unique = $.grep(a, function(element) {
    return $.inArray(element, b) == -1;
});

var result = unique ;

alert(result); 

...I am able to find which element of Array "a" is not in Array "b".

Now I need to find:

  • if an element of Array "a" is in Array "b"
  • what is its index in Array "b"

For example "Random data" is in both arrays, so I need to return its position in Array b which is zero index.

Regarding your comment, here is a solution:

with jQuery:

$.each( a, function( key, value ) {
    var index = $.inArray( value, b );
    if( index != -1 ) {
        console.log( index );
    }
});

without jQuery:

a.forEach( function( value ) {
    if( b.indexOf( value ) != -1 ) {
       console.log( b.indexOf( value ) );
    }
});

You could just iterate over a and use Array.prototype.indexOf to get the index of the element in b, if indexOf returns -1 b does not contain the element of a.

var a = [...], b = [...]
a.forEach(function(el) {
    if(b.indexOf(el) > 0) console.log(b.indexOf(el));
    else console.log("b does not contain " + el);
});

You can try this:

var a = ['volvo','random data'];
var b = ['random data'];
$.each(a,function(i,val){
var result=$.inArray(val,b);
if(result!=-1)
alert(result); 
})
